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$204.90 | 4.665% | $214.4586 | $214.46 | $214.45 | $214.50 |
Purchase #2 | $192.87 | 6.171% | $204.772 | $204.77 | $204.75 | $204.80 |
Purchase #3 | $158.81 | 8.139% | $171.7355 | $171.74 | $171.75 | $171.70 |
Purchase #4 | $81.85 | 11.690% | $91.4183 | $91.42 | $91.40 | $91.40 |
Purchase #5 | $119.54 | 8.624% | $129.8491 | $129.85 | $129.85 | $129.80 |
Purchase #6 | $52.41 | 5.190% | $55.1301 | $55.13 | $55.15 | $55.10 |
Purchase #7 | $100.94 | 10.409% | $111.4468 | $111.45 | $111.45 | $111.40 |
7 purchase totals = | $911.32 | $978.8104 | $978.82 | $978.80 | $978.70 |
